Lauryn Hill Celebrates 25 Years at Mohegan Sun
by Carissa Chesanek - Oct 16, 2023


Over the weekend, Lauryn Hill took the stage at Mohegan Sun Arena in Connecticut. The performance by the legendary rapper and singer celebrated the 25th anniversary of the Grammy-winning album Miseducation of Lauryn Hill.

Battle Of The NYC Boroughs Announced At Amateur Night At The Apollo, July 26
by A.A. Cristi - Jul 6, 2023


On Wednesday, July 26, 12 contestants from across Manhattan, Brooklyn, Queens, Bronx, Staten Island, and New Jersey will take the famed Amateur Night at the Apollo stage to compete for bragging rights, and a chance to win $20,000. In a night of neighborhood rivalry, artists from the five New York City boroughs and New Jersey will bring their singing, dancing, and more to Harlem and to the nation's original talent show, Amateur Night at The Apollo.
